  • Abstract
    This paper applies a modified composite radic(2) subdivision framework to an extensive family of box splines, and therefore generalizes these box splines to irregular control meshes. Particularly, a variant of the quad subdivision of Peters and Shiue (2004) is shown as a special case of the new framework. In addition, a new dual subdivision scheme is also derived, as a generalization of some special box splines. Towards the practical use, the unified framework is also extended for modelling boundary and crease features.
